Spain: Longoria, The Village, Ready For Eva Longoria
More than 400 years after her ancestors left for the Americas, "Desperate Housewives" star Eva Longoria Parker can expect a joyous welcome when she visits the remote northern Spain village that bears her name.The village of Longoria, home to around 60 people whose average age is 70, lies in the green hills of the Asturias region.
Eva Longoria Parker plans to visit next month to retrace her roots back to the place which her ancestors are believed to have left in 1603 to try their luck in the Americas.
